HB 1466 North Dakota House · 69th Legislative Assembly (2025-26)

AN ACT to amend and reenact sections 5-01-01 and 5-01-19.1, and subsection 2 of section 5-01-19.2 of the North Dakota Century Code, relating to the definitions of a domestic and manufacturing distillery and satellite locations.

HB 1466 proposes changes to the North Dakota Century Code regarding distilleries. Specifically, it amends the definitions of both domestic and manufacturing distilleries, clarifying their legal classifications. The bill also updates the regulations governing satellite locations associated with these distilleries. This legislation directly affects businesses that produce and sell distilled spirits in the state by modifying the rules for their operations and potential additional retail points.

This bill updates North Dakota's alcohol definitions and distillery regulations to reflect new production thresholds and clarify the roles of domestic and manufacturing distilleries. The changes expand the definition of a manufacturing distillery from 25,000 to 40,000 gallons per year and introduce a new category for domestic distilleries with up to 12,000 gallons capacity. These updates modernize the legal framework to accommodate the growing craft distillery industry while maintaining clear distinctions between different types of alcohol producers.
Scope change
The bill expands the scope of what constitutes a manufacturing distillery and adds a new category for smaller domestic distilleries, affecting eligibility for different regulatory requirements and sales privileges.
DEFINITION

Changed the definition of manufacturing distillery from producing 25,000 gallons to 40,000 gallons or fewer of distilled spirits per year.

Added a new definition for domestic distillery as a facility producing 12,000 gallons or fewer of spirits per year.

Updated the definition of domestic distillery from 25,000 gallons to 94,635 liters or fewer to align with metric measurements.

Updated the definition of manufacturing distillery from 25,000 gallons to 151,416 liters or fewer to align with metric measurements.

REQUIREMENT

Added new Section 5-01-19.1 establishing rules for direct sales by domestic distilleries to licensed retailers, including delivery methods and annual case limits.
